BEIJING -- Xi Jinping stressed promoting high-standard opening up in a report to the 20th National Congress of the Communist Party of China on Sunday.
China will steadily expand institutional opening up with regard to rules, regulations, management, and standards, Xi said.
Efforts will be made to accelerate the country's transformation into a trader of quality, promote the high-quality development of the Belt and Road Initiative, and preserve the diversity and stability of the international economic landscape and economic and trade relations, Xi said.
